Is it safe to assume you've replaced all the paper and electrolytic caps, as well as checked resistor values in the vertical circuit? That would be the first step. Not sure how you're getting 115V on pin 5(grid) of the 6V6, unless you're measuring AC volts? There should only be a 3.3 meg resistor going to ground and one end of a .1uf cap tied to that pin. Pins 2 and 7 are the heater supply and should have around 6.3Vac across them. Pin 6 has no internal connection to the 6V6 and must be a tie point for some other point in the circuit. Better double check the wiring around that stage.

Could you have disconnected the 4.7meg resistor R55 and accidentally re-connected it to the other side of the 0.1uF coupling cap C63? That might explain why you have 115V on the grid of the 6V6, 5V on the plate of the 6SN7, and lack of vertical sweep.

Clean the entire HV area, especially that socket, with isopropyl alcohol (rubbing alcohol). Also look under the 1B3 socket for resistors. I have found burned ones there.
